The Basset artésien normand one is recognized by the FCI French breed (FCI Group 6, section 1.3, Standard No. 34).

Description

The Basset artésien normand for its size (up to 36 cm) very long. The hair is short, close fitting but not too fine, in the colors of fawn with black coat and white ( tri-color) or fawn with white ( bicolor). The ears are set as low as possible, never above the eye line; thin, very long, at least as long as the fishing, preferably ending in a point. Its direct ancestor is the Basset d' Artois, who came up in this race and is now considered extinct.

Use

Like all Bassets he is a dog for hunting small game. Due to its short runs thickets are not a problem for him. He hunts with track volume, ie barking, alone or in a group. It is very robust and is often kept as a companion dog.
